4 Subject: [PATCH] ohci-platform: Add support for devicetree instantiation
5
6 Add support for ohci-platform instantiation from devicetree, including
7 optionally getting clks and a phy from devicetree, and enabling / disabling
8 those on power_on / off.
9
10 This should allow using ohci-platform from devicetree in various cases.
11 Specifically after this commit it can be used for the ohci controller found
12 on Allwinner sunxi SoCs.

28 +USB OHCI controllers
29 +
30 +Required properties:
31 +- compatible : "usb-ohci"
32 +- reg : ohci controller register range (address and length)
33 +- interrupts : ohci controller interrupt
34 +
35 +Optional properties:
36 +- clocks : a list of phandle + clock specifier pairs
37 +- phys : phandle + phy specifier pair
38 +- phy-names : "usb"
39 +
40 +Example:
41 +
42 + ohci0: usb@01c14400 {
43 + compatible = "allwinner,sun4i-a10-ohci", "usb-ohci";
44 + reg = <0x01c14400 0x100>;
45 + interrupts = <64>;
46 + clocks = <&usb_clk 6>, <&ahb_gates 2>;
47 + phys = <&usbphy 1>;
48 + phy-names = "usb";
49 + };
